Saturday, January 6th

Alsager Book Emporium is open again from 10 am until 2 pm.

Alsager Town Football Club aka The Bullets are at home to Cheadle Heath Nomads with a 3 pm kick-off.

Monday, January 8th

Fancy getting fit as well as meeting new friends? Dance teacher, Mark Farrugia is at Alsager Civic with his Strictly Dance Fit classes from 6 pm until 7 pm. Here's a story we wrote about him here
